MU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

655 of the 3,447 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Micron Technology (MU)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$34.8B — up 2.4% from $34B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 74 funds opened new MU positions and 64 closed out — a net gain of 10 holders — while 279 added to existing stakes and 238 trimmed.

The largest buyer was D.E. Shaw & Co, adding an estimated $167M. The largest seller was Norges Bank, cutting an estimated $321M.
